Recognize Meg Morris for 15 Years of Service to the Monterey Public Library and the City of Monterey Action: Recognized On behalf of the Library Board and Library, Chair Koenig and Interim Library Director Waite thanked Library Assistant Morris. Technical Services Supervisor Cunha shared the following with trustees and staff: Meg began her career at Monterey Public Library as a Reference Page, a position she held for seven years, during which time she was recognized as an “Employee of the Moment” for service over and above her regularly assigned duties. In September 2000, Meg was promoted to an RPT Library Assistant I position in Technical Services, where her diligence, attention to detail and dependability made her an effective team member. When I joined the Technical Services staff in 2008, Meg trained me in many cataloging and processing procedures, and was also my go-to person for any historic information about Technical Services, or the library in general. In November 2014, Meg was promoted to a full-time Library Assistant II position. In addition to doing nearly all the copy cataloging for Technical Services, a huge job and even larger responsibility, Meg has successfully added some new capabilities to her repertoire. Library Board of Trustees Minutes Wednesday, October 28, 2015  She trained and supervised three pages in processing materials, ensuring the workflow in our department kept moving steadily and our output kept close to normal even though we were down a staff member.  She also became my backup in acquisitions. Her new skills in ordering and receiving were recently put to the test when I went on a 3-week vacation. Naturally, she fulfilled expectations with flying colors. What I appreciated most about Meg is that she is always thinking, whether it is about creating a more efficient workflow, streamlining a process or improving our service to customers. Meg’s contributions to our department and the library over the past fifteen years have been too numerous to mention. She is resourceful, reliable, dedicated and the backbone of the Technical Services team. It gives me great pleasure to recognize Meg for her fifteen years of service to the Monterey Public Library and a job not just well, but superbly done. Please join me in congratulating her. 3. Receive Report from the Ad Hoc Strategic Plan Subcommittee Action: Received and discussed Interim Library Director Waite shared that the Ad Hoc Strategic Plan Subcommittee met on October 9 and provided direction to develop Strategic Plan priorities through the end of 2016. Trustee Yamanishi attended Harrison Memorial Library’s community workshop on reimagining the library. She encouraged goals placed under the topics of create, explore, and experience, and reflected on the 21st century library which she expressed would consist of reaching the community outside library walls. Receive Report on Neighborhood Improvement Program (NIP) Projects and Capital Improvement Program (CIP) Projects Action: Received and discussed Interim Library Director Waite shared that the winter weatherizing of the roof was complete and that the NIP kitchen and lighting projects are delayed due to funding. 10. Receive Report on Progress of Proposed Reorganization Action: Received and discussed Interim Library Director Waite reviewed the proposed reorganization chart and position changes which included adding one full-time Grants & Volunteer Coordinator, one full-time Executive Assistant II, reclassifying two Library Assistant I’s to Library Assistant II, adding one full-time Technology & Digital Access Manager and one full-time Public Engagement & Programs Manager. She noted that these were not fixed titles. Library Board Meeting Minutes Wednesday, October 28, 2015 3 Library Board of Trustees Minutes Wednesday, October 28, 2015 The Ad Hoc Finance Subcommittee was unable to meet with the finance team, which has been providing guidance on the Library’s reorganization, due to last-minute cancellations from the City Manager, Assistant City Manager, and Finance Director. The Subcommittee met with the newly hired Human Resources Director. Trustee Castagna: As the liaison for the Friends, he attended the October Friends Board meeting and reported that Claire Rygg was selected as the new president and that the October wish list that will fund the California History Room’s window treatment was approved. Upcoming events include the Giant Used Book Sale and the Big Sur International Marathon on November 6 & 7, 2015. The next Little Free Library will be installed at Montecito Park. Trustee Koenig: Commended staff for the Library remaining open during the power outage, especially maintaining the ability to check-out books.
